"I am trying real hard to like this restaurant, but after 3 attempts, I can only give La Rosa 2 stars.The portions are extremely small for the price. I recently ordered, what I thought was a substantial amount of food for 5 adults and the employee who took my order confirmed the quantity of main side dishes would more than enough to feed a group of 5. She couldn’t have been more incorrect! When I opened the containers, I said “You have got to be kidding me.” The pizza restaurant we frequent in town, put La Rosa to shame.To add insult not only was the penna vodka dry and tasteless, but they used rigatoni pasta for penna vodka! The pickup was an early Sunday evening, hence before the dinner rush, and our eggplant was still dried out as if it had been sitting out for quite sometime. And add insult, when placing my order for bread, which in all of my years dining in a restaurant is a common request. Not here , I was charged for over baked pizza dough, which was supposed to resemble your normal Italian bread, this could be further from the truth.In all fairness, I will say their thin crust pizza is good, but not in the same league, as pizza found on Arthur Ave.Bon Appetite!"